Petra Wanitschka
Petra Wanitschka (born December 8, 1966 in Cologne ; † on the night of September 1, 2015 ) was a German radio presenter .
Life
Petra Wanitschka grew up in Cologne, where he made the Humboldt High School its Abitur . She then studied English, Spanish and German at the University of Cologne .
In 1985 she began to present at WDR 2 , between 1986 and 1990 she could be heard on SWF3 . From 1992 Wanitschka worked for three years as a presenter, speaker and reporter for Deutsche Welle . Between 1995 and 2000 she moderated the morning crew in the NDR youth wave N-Joy . From 2000 to 2003 she moderated at NDR 2 .
This was followed by a detour to television, Wanitschka worked as a reporter and director for the regional program Hamburg Journal of NDR television . Between 2003 and 2010, Wanitschka could be heard on the Schleswig-Holstein station NDR 1 Welle Nord , before switching to the sister station NDR 1 Radio MV in Mecklenburg-Western Pomerania in 2010 . There she last moderated the morning show Wanitschka at work .
Petra Wanitschka died, according to the North German Broadcasting Corporation, on the night of September 1st, 2015 after a long, serious illness.
